Freight traffic will box residents in
To the editor: We are writing to voice our concern regarding the CN Railroad. We live in the vicinity of Cuba Road and Route 59. If the freight train traffic increases as the CN Railroad says it will, it will be very difficult for us to even get out of our neighborhood due to the traffic backup caused by the increased number and the length of the trains.
Route 59 and Ela Road are congested everyday now. Increased train traffic will make these roads impassable. Regardless of the inconvenience of daily travel, a major concern is road accessibility to emergency vehicles. Downtown Barrington has its own struggles and increased train traffic that will cause increased traffic jams, will discourage people from shopping, dining or doing business in Barrington.
CN Railroad is doing the right thing in transporting products that benefit all of us. However, CN Railroad needs to do the RIGHT thing for the people that live and/or travel through the Barrington area. There are solutions and CN Railroad needs to DO THE RIGHT THING!
